1. Shri Kukday, learned counsel for the applicant/appellant, by tendering pursis dated 19.08.2024 across the bar accompanied by the judgment in Claim Petition No.535/2016 dated 04.07.2023, which is taken on record, submits that in the claim petition, which is decided on merits, the appellant has been exonerated from liability, therefore, the present appeal filed against the order of liability becomes infructuous.
2. In view of above, the civil application as well as first appeal stand disposed of as infructuous. No costs.
